Output f303ce814bf1060b6946866cb1d376804c8f7984d8cf94552b2032f5c452b393:12

value
9402831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0014486931313084ad3413f44a26fb3684da941 OP_EQUAL
address
3LeqzXN5UE2z5xt53YAxLuD4QrhzmBtWKn
transaction
f303ce814bf1060b6946866cb1d376804c8f7984d8cf94552b2032f5c452b393
confirmations
266447
spent
true